Fix retry logic for vibrator HAL requests

Update VibratorHalController to only reconnect with the IVibrator HAL
service and retry the operation if a transaction error or dead object
code is received.

This will avoid retrying vibrator calls with bad values when the error
code is illegal argument, for example, or when the vibrator is
returning illegal state.
